使用eclipse运行maven项目

使用eclipse运行maven项目,maven,eclipse-plugin,fedora,Maven,Eclipse Plugin,Fedora,我不熟悉maven和eclipse。我在eclipse中添加了m2e插件,并导入了一个我在网上找到的maven项目示例。 我的问题是,当我尝试在eclipse中使用runas项菜单运行项目时,我没有找到maven包菜单,正如我在不同的教程中学习的那样 这是一个安装问题吗?好的,让我们一步一步地完成这一步骤,以确保您拥有启动所需的一切 首先,确保已经安装了Maven(假设已经安装了Java)。您可以从下载它,Fedora的安装说明(我假设您是从标签中使用的)在页面的下方 要测试Maven是否正确安

我不熟悉
maven
eclipse
。我在
eclipse
中添加了
m2e插件
,并导入了一个我在网上找到的maven项目示例。 我的问题是,当我尝试在
eclipse
中使用
runas
项菜单运行项目时,我没有找到
maven包
菜单,正如我在不同的教程中学习的那样


这是一个安装问题吗?

好的,让我们一步一步地完成这一步骤,以确保您拥有启动所需的一切

首先,确保已经安装了Maven(假设已经安装了Java)。您可以从下载它,Fedora的安装说明(我假设您是从标签中使用的)在页面的下方

要测试Maven是否正确安装和工作,请在终端中键入
mvn--help
。Eclipse和m2e基本上只是跳到终端上查看与Maven相关的所有内容,所以在继续之前确保这一切正常

接下来下载一个合适的Eclipse版本。为了这个例子,我下载了开普勒版本的JavaEEIDE。在这个版本的EclipseM2e是捆绑的,要检查这一点,您可以转到
帮助>关于Eclipse>安装详细信息
并在插件选项卡上看到m2e连接器

现在您可以将Maven项目导入Eclipse。要执行此操作,请转到
File>Import
,然后在Maven部分下选择现有的Maven项目。选择包含已下载示例项目的目录,然后完成


现在,确保在示例Maven项目中打开了一些文件,当您转到
runas…
时,您现在应该能够看到Maven选项。转到
runas>Maven build…
,您只需将单词package放在Goals字段中,就可以开始了。

如果您还没有将项目转换为Maven项目,请右键单击Eclipse项目/包资源管理器中的项目。然后是:

Configure -> Convert to Maven Project

之后,您可以再次右键单击项目
以运行方式运行
,您将看到执行项目构建/安装/清理等的所有Maven可能性。

在配置中,只有
转换为插件项目
。您确定
m2e插件安装顺利吗?如果不是,请再次尝试卸载并安装它,因为如果安装良好,您应该会看到
Configure Maven Project
,或者您可以通过新建项目看到
Maven Project
。你能通过
Windows->Preferences
查看列表中的
Maven
吗?如果是,请展开
Maven
选项并检查
安装中选择的内容。我认为您应该选择
嵌入式
安装选项。但是我建议您单独安装Maven(外部),并且该安装应该是要使用的安装。我单独安装了
Maven
,并在
Window->Preferences
中将
Embedded
更改为新的Maven版本,但是当我选择
Configure->…
only
Convert to plug-in project
found时,我得到了同样的结果。您使用的Eclipse版本是什么?尝试创建一个新项目,但通过选择
Other
(CTRL+N)
选择Maven project,如果您没有看到
Maven project
,则插件安装不正确。如果可行,请尝试安装新的Eclipse。谢谢Martin,您的解决方案是构建项目的一个选项,但我想知道如何显示菜单并直接使用它们。@Hocine我已经添加了您从头开始运行所需的一切。希望有帮助。